Output 59cc9a5a5c24e335d985eb240b0d23951ee5f425c92cd3cfde575c05258d3aed:0

value
838243
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4588d0f62f1c93c32e67f66e1486f4090fc24382 OP_EQUAL
address
382gSwV7E8YcVuXmA75tgzoD6Sg4Qpi6gb
transaction
59cc9a5a5c24e335d985eb240b0d23951ee5f425c92cd3cfde575c05258d3aed
confirmations
297384
spent
true